5.8 Individual testing
With individual testing the user can choose which
headlamps are to be tested. The test sequence can also
be selected.
5.8.1 Vehicle settings
! Devices with a trolley must be individually aligned for
each headlamp using the alignment laser.
! The inclination of the headlamp cut-off must be
inaccordance with legal requirements based on
ECEstandards:
$ For low beams max. 80 cm from the ground, the
inclination must be at least 1 %.
$ For low beams more than 80 cm from the ground,
the inclination must be at least 1.5 %.
The "Settings" menu appears after selecting the type of
test. Enter the typical vehicle settings in this menu.

Fig. 38: "Settings" menu
1. Enter the type of vehicle:
$ Motor vehicles (cars and trucks): Two headlamps
$ Motorcycle: One headlamp
$ Mopeds: One low beam only
2. Enter the type of headlamp:
$ EU asymmetrical
$ EU symmetrical
$ UK
3. Enter the type of light:
$ Halogen
$ Xenon
$ Bi-Xenon
$ LED
$ Bi-LED
4. Enter the headlamp inclination: Read off the cut-off
inclination specified by the manufacturer (e.g.1.2%)
from the top of the headlamp. Adjust the value with
the + and keys.
5. Height: Adjust the distance of the headlamp from the
ground with the + and keys.
6. Confirm with OK if all the entries are correct.
7. A query appears asking whether the fog lamps are to
be tested.
Fig. 39: Fog lamp query
8. Confirm the query with Yes if the vehicle is fitted
with a fog lamp. If fog lamp testing is not to be
performed, respond to the query with No.
"Individual testing can then be started.
i Use the +/- keys to adjust the test specifications
if the specified inclination differs from the
manufacturer's data.
